At the heart of the red cast iron pot’s charm lies its unparalleled heat retention and distribution capabilities. Unlike many modern lightweight cookware pieces, cast iron prides itself on its density. This feature ensures that the pot can maintain a consistent temperature and offers an even cooking surface, vital for intricate recipes that require meticulous heat control. I have personally tackled everything from simmering soups to concocting robust stews, and every time, the pot’s ability to uniformly distribute heat across its surface shines through. This predictability in performance makes it indispensable, particularly for slow-cooked dishes where flavors need time to meld perfectly. Equally compelling is the pot’s ability to seamlessly move from stovetop to oven. In the hectic flow of meal preparation, the flexibility offered by the red cast iron pot cannot be overstated. Its robustness means it can withstand high temperatures that most other pots would shy away from. This is especially useful for those one-pot recipes that are initiated on the stovetop for searing and require a finish in the oven to lock in moisture and introduce a crispy texture. From a professional standpoint, the significance of the enamel coating, characteristic of many red cast iron pots, deserves mention. This enamel finish negates the need for traditional seasoning associated with raw cast iron. The layer presents a non-reactive surface making it ideal for cooking acidic dishes that would typically degrade uncoated cookware. My expert insight reveals that the enamel also ensures ease of cleaning, paving the way for more ambitious culinary endeavors without dreading the aftermath of sticking or staining.
